From f693e3eef0e8772a8221af6559c11f5e5e3ea5ba Mon Sep 17 00:00:00 2001 From: monkey <693696817@qq.com> Date: Thu, 11 Sep 2025 10:47:59 +0000 Subject: [PATCH] =?UTF-8?q?update=20app/services/ai=5Fanalysis=5Fservice.p?= =?UTF-8?q?y.=20class=20AIAnalysisService:=20=20=20=20=20def=20=5F=5Finit?= =?UTF-8?q?=5F=5F(self):=20=20=20=20=20=20=20=20=20#=20=E9=85=8D=E7=BD=AEO?= =?UTF-8?q?penAI=E5=AE=A2=E6=88=B7=E7=AB=AF=E8=BF=9E=E6=8E=A5=E5=88=B0Volc?= =?UTF-8?q?es=20API=20=20=20=20=20=20=20=20=20self.model=20=3D=20""=20=20#?= =?UTF-8?q?=20Volces=20=E6=A8=A1=E5=9E=8B=E6=8E=A5=E5=85=A5=E7=82=B9ID=20?= =?UTF-8?q?=20=20=20=20=20=20=20=20self.client=20=3D=20OpenAI(=20=20=20=20?= =?UTF-8?q?=20=20=20=20=20=20=20=20=20api=5Fkey=20=3D=20"",=20=20#=20?= =?UTF-8?q?=E8=B1=86=E5=8C=85=E5=A4=A7=E6=A8=A1=E5=9E=8BAPIkey=20=20=20=20?= =?UTF-8?q?=20=20=20=20=20=20=20=20=20base=5Furl=20=3D=20"https://ark.cn-b?= =?UTF-8?q?eijing.volces.com/api/v3"=20=20=20=20=20=20=20=20=20)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: monkey <693696817@qq.com> --- app/services/ai_analysis_service.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/app/services/ai_analysis_service.py b/app/services/ai_analysis_service.py index a8de894..8f6b2ed 100644 --- a/app/services/ai_analysis_service.py +++ b/app/services/ai_analysis_service.py @@ -6,10 +6,10 @@ from app.config import Config class AIAnalysisService: def __init__(self): # 配置OpenAI客户端连接到Volces API - self.model = os.getenv('VOLCES_MODEL_ID', 'your_model_id_here') # 从环境变量获取 + self.model = "" # Volces 模型接入点ID self.client = OpenAI( - api_key = os.getenv('VOLCES_API_KEY', 'your_api_key_here'), # 从环境变量获取 - base_url = os.getenv('VOLCES_BASE_URL', 'https://ark.cn-beijing.volces.com/api/v3') + api_key = "", # 豆包大模型APIkey + base_url = "https://ark.cn-beijing.volces.com/api/v3" ) # 创建AI分析结果缓存目录 self.cache_dir = os.path.join(Config.BASE_DIR, "ai_stock_analysis")